Galvin-USA TODAY SportsWith most of free agency in the books, Pro Football Focus looked across each team in the NFL and evaluated which position groups were the most improved based on the moves made. Among the top improved units were the Raiders’ wide receivers, Packers’ pass rush, Bills’ offensive line, Jets’ running backs, and then the defensive line of your Cleveland Browns.Here is a comparison of how the Browns’ starting defensive line graded in 2018, versus how they would’ve graded with the additions now made in 2019:Here is how PFF highlighted the changes Cleveland has made on the line:DE Olivier Vernon missed time to injury last year, but still graded out with an 86.3. He “consistently beat his blocker with a pass-rush win rate of 18.2% – ninth among 101 edge defenders with at least 150 regular season pass-rush snaps.” In terms of overall grade, Vernon’s 86.3 is a massive upgrade over DE Emmanuel Ogbah’s grade of 58.9.DT Sheldon Richardson has always been a consistent player, playing over 600 snaps and grading as a 70.0+ player each season. When he is playing at his best, he is an elite run defender. Over the past couple seasons Womens David Njoku Jersey , he hasn’t been an elite run defender, but “has remained solid as both a pass rusher and run defender, providing a clear upgrade on the 614 defensive snaps played by Trevon Coley on the interior in 2018.”One can only expect that the Browns would like to find a third key pass rusher from the defensive end spot, as well as a depth guy they really like inside. Those guys may already be on the roster in DE Chad Thomas and DT Carl Davis, but need to show something after practically being red-shirted last year in their first years in Cleveland. And he did.What the metrics sayFootball Outsiders has methods of attempting to separate the performance of an offensive line in the running game from a running back. You can read more on their methodology here, but it boils down to this:“We know that at some point in every long running play, the running back has gotten past all of his offensive line blocks. From here on, the rest of the play is dependent on the runner’s own speed and elusiveness, combined with the speed and tackling ability of the defensive players. If [a running back] breaks through the line for 50 yards, avoiding tacklers all the way to the goal line, his offensive line has done a great job -- but they aren’t responsible for most of that run.”From this line of thinking, FBO develops a few relevant metrics:Adjusted Line Yards This metric takes all running back carries and assigns responsibility to the offensive line based on the following percentages:Losses: 120% value0-4 Yards: 100% value5-10 Yards: 50% value11+ Yards: 0% valueThen Football Outsiders adjusts that yardage. But essentially, a higher number here means the team is making it easier for it’s RBs.Browns Rank: 18thOpen Field Yards From FBO: “gives the portion of the team’s rushing average gained after the first 10 yards of each run. So for a 10-yard run Odell Beckham Browns Jersey , no yards are counted; for a 15-yard run, five yards are counted; for an 80-yard run, 70 yards are counted. This number gives you an idea of how much of a team’s running game was based on the breakaway speed of the running backs.”Browns Rank: 4thStuffs These are the % of runs stopped at or behind the line of scrimmage.Browns Rank: 29th best (4th worst)Power SuccessThis is the % of runs on 3rd or 4th down with less than 2 yards to go that the offense converted. Browns Rank: 32nd (worst in the NFL)What does all this mean?From FBO:“A team with a low ranking in Adjusted Line Yards but a high ranking in Open Field Yards is heavily dependent on its running back breaking long runs to make the running game work.”The Browns were just about average in Adjusted Line Yards (18th), and very good in Open Field Yards (4th), which means that we depended on Nick Chubb breaking long runs to make the running game work. The fact that we were near the bottom of the league in Power Success and Stuffs is also a fairly negative reflection on our line/scheme from a year ago. It isn’t typically a running back’s fault when he’s hit in the backfield for a loss. Grinding out those tough yards on 3rd and short when everyone in the stadium knows you’re running requires a great plan or a great line.
